Output 3ed76f0352070e166c52825fa2ec7c72638b192e67ca20473701c8b15dd7d1ea:1

value
6879661827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ad9b2341b72a42842601027a5292dc9f0a908aa OP_EQUAL
address
3BRzLfj7MPsfWnzqZA48C97LGM3xJnEA9E
transaction
3ed76f0352070e166c52825fa2ec7c72638b192e67ca20473701c8b15dd7d1ea
spent
true